I was wondering if it was possible to take image when iPad is in split view. Currently, I am using FieldMaps and Survey123 in split view serving as data viewer and inspection form, respectively. "Camera not ready" message box appears when user is asked to take an image when both applications are docked. The camera functions as normal when survey123 is returned to full-screen--which is all right, but they must redock apps in split view afterward.

NEVERTHELESS, when body::esri:style is set to "method=map" split screen continues to work.

I am wondering if I could override user having to go full screen in order to take image, such as method=map functionality?

Unfortunately I don't believe this is not possible, as Field Maps appears to be locking the camera while in split view, meaning that Survey123 can not access it until Field Maps is closed, or Survey123 has full app view, and Field Maps put to background. The camera can only be used by one app at a time based on the way iOS allows access to resources on the device.

Setting the method=map means the camera is not used as only a map screenshot is used, so the camera is not initiated for use.
